In 1953 (a years before the film by Vittorio De Sica) was published the book "The sea is not wet Naples" by Anna Maria Ortese, which won the Viareggio Prize ex aequo with "Tales of the duchy in flames" by Carlo Emilio Gadda. Ortese was part of the book of investigative journalism also called "Golden Fork" that had already been published in 1951 under the title The World The mob queen. As I post here is a short track because it seems very modern, and because, after the release of De Sica's film, there were conflicts of Naples lit image that came from the books of Marotta and that is quite different from the books that came out of Rea, Prisco, orthoses.
